| 0:00.0 | Welcome to the team house. I'm Jack Murphy here with today's guest, Dan Dobis, who served in the Drug Enforcement Agency, had a good long career after a stint in the Army, college education, and then was sent all over the world with the DEA. Thanks for joining us today, Dan. |
| 0:17.8 | No problem, Jack. Thanks for having me. |
| 0:20.6 | This interview was supposed to be in studio, |
| 0:23.5 | originally, but it's just as well that that didn't happen. Dan has a new job. He's starting. |
| 0:30.3 | Our producer, Dmitri, would have had to drive through some kind of crappy conditions in the |
| 0:34.2 | city. And I'm getting a cold, so I apologize if my voice sounds a little rasty |
| 0:38.9 | during this interview. Dan, tell us a little bit, if we begin at the beginning here, |
| 0:47.0 | with your origin. Tell us about, you know, how you grew up, where you grew up, and kind of how |
| 0:53.2 | that took you into the next phase of your life. |
| 0:56.5 | Sure. |
| 0:57.1 | So I was born in Bridgeport, Connecticut, and we lived there until I was about five in the same |
| 1:04.0 | house that my father was born in and his family lived in since the early 1910s. |
| 1:10.3 | And then we moved to Trumbull, Connecticut, which was the |
| 1:13.2 | suburb north of Bridgeport. I grew up playing sports. And it was like football in the fall, |
| 1:21.8 | basketball in the winter, baseball in the spring, baseball in the summer, swimming in the summer, |
| 1:26.1 | but also playing war in the woods |
| 1:30.5 | with my friends and my brother. We got toy guns every Christmas, everything from like Tommy guns |
| 1:39.1 | that made noise to sawed off shotguns that shot, you know, rubber darts. |
| 1:46.4 | But my father had been in the Army Reserve in the mid-60s, and one of my uncles was in the |
| 1:53.7 | Marines during the Korean War. |
| 1:55.4 | But other than that, nobody in the family was in the military. |
